Transaction 312253ea4dfb7cd20bbddc265e2e65575ac243f4651d3d18a31f3e94388810d1
1 Input
1 Output
-
312253ea4dfb7cd20bbddc265e2e65575ac243f4651d3d18a31f3e94388810d1:0
- value
- 95497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da50981c2dcf92e7a369cbb934f5d46199c30539 OP_EQUAL
- address
- 3MbMn9Ld7YUwJ3L82jbNPYBhyfDGuCbSHD